Thus, farm fish become healthier than production and a few heads of livestock to wild fish (Segner et al., 2012). Web2 Our list comprises countries that are both small and poor. Countries are considered small if they account for less than 0.05 percent of the world’s imports of goods and services. Poor countries are those that are defined as low income by the World Bank (per capita GDP in purchasing power parity (PPP) terms of US$4,630 or below).

WebThe largest brain drain rates are observed in small, poor countries in the tropics, and they rise over the 1990s. The worst-affected countries see more than 80% of their “brains” emigrating abroad, such as for Haiti, Jamaica, and several small states with fewer than . WebOct 7, 2024 · The Caribbean economy contracted an estimated 8.6% in 2024, and by 12.6% excluding Guyana. Many jobs are affected, and a recent high frequency phone survey in one of the Caribbean small states suggests that poverty headcounts are rising, though the magnitude and duration of this increase will depend on the pace of economic recovery.
